Prior

Prior en la IA

El prior en inteligencia artificial es una herramienta fundamental que representa el conocimiento o creencias iniciales sobre un problema antes de observar nuevos datos. En los modelos bayesianos, el prior se combina con la información actual para actualizar las probabilidades y tomar decisiones más informadas. Su uso permite incorporar experiencia previa o supuestos, mejorando la capacidad del modelo para generalizar y manejar incertidumbre. Sin embargo, elegir un prior adecuado es crucial, ya que uno mal seleccionado puede sesgar los resultados. En áreas como el aprendizaje automático y la visión por computadora, el prior ayuda a regularizar modelos y evitar sobreajuste.

Fundamentos Bayesianos y el Rol del Prior

Los fundamentos bayesianos en inteligencia artificial se basan en el teorema de Bayes, que permite actualizar la probabilidad de una hipótesis a medida que se obtienen nuevos datos. En este proceso, el prior representa la creencia inicial sobre esa hipótesis antes de observar la evidencia. El rol del prior es fundamental, ya que sirve como punto de partida para la inferencia y se combina con la verosimilitud, que refleja la probabilidad de los datos dados los parámetros. El resultado es la distribución posterior, que actualiza nuestras creencias de forma dinámica y racional. Este enfoque es especialmente útil cuando los datos son limitados o inciertos. Además, los priors pueden incorporar conocimiento experto, facilitando decisiones más informadas. 

Tipos de Priors

Existen varios tipos de priors en inteligencia artificial, cada uno con un propósito específico. Los priors informativos se basan en conocimiento previo concreto y aportan información útil al modelo. Por otro lado, los priors no informativos o vagos buscan minimizar la influencia previa, permitiendo que los datos tengan mayor peso en la inferencia. También están los priors conjugados, elegidos por su propiedad matemática de facilitar el cálculo de la distribución posterior. Además, existen priors jerárquicos que modelan relaciones más complejas entre parámetros. La elección del tipo de prior depende del contexto y la disponibilidad de información previa. 

Importancia del Prior en los Modelos Probabilísticos

El prior es fundamental en los modelos probabilísticos porque aporta el conocimiento previo que guía la inferencia cuando los datos son escasos o ruidosos. Su influencia es crucial para obtener resultados más estables y confiables, especialmente en situaciones con poca información disponible. Un prior bien diseñado puede mejorar la precisión y evitar que el modelo se sobreajuste a datos específicos. Por el contrario, un prior inapropiado puede sesgar los resultados y reducir la calidad de las predicciones. Además, el prior permite incorporar experiencia o supuestos expertos, enriqueciendo el modelo.

Aplicaciones del Prior en Machine Learning

El prior en machine learning se utiliza para incorporar conocimiento previo y mejorar la capacidad de los modelos para generalizar. En algoritmos bayesianos, los priors ayudan a regularizar el aprendizaje, evitando el sobreajuste cuando los datos son limitados o ruidosos. También se aplican en modelos jerárquicos para manejar estructuras complejas y en redes neuronales bayesianas para estimar la incertidumbre en las predicciones. Además, el prior facilita la integración de información externa o experiencia previa, lo que puede acelerar el entrenamiento y mejorar la robustez. En sistemas de recomendación o visión por computadora, los priors guían las decisiones cuando la evidencia es ambigua.

Prior en Redes Neuronales Bayesianas

En las redes neuronales bayesianas, el prior juega un papel clave al modelar la incertidumbre sobre los pesos de la red. A diferencia de las redes tradicionales, que asignan valores fijos a los parámetros, las bayesianas tratan los pesos como distribuciones probabilísticas. El prior representa la creencia inicial sobre estos pesos antes de observar los datos, y se combina con la verosimilitud para obtener una distribución posterior más ajustada. Esto permite que la red no solo haga predicciones, sino que también indique cuán segura está de ellas. La elección del prior afecta directamente la regularización del modelo, controlando su complejidad.

Métodos Automáticos para Definir Priors

Los métodos automáticos para definir priors buscan reducir la subjetividad en su elección y adaptar el modelo al contexto específico de los datos. Uno de los enfoques más comunes es el uso de priors empíricos, que se estiman directamente a partir de los datos disponibles. También se emplean priors jerárquicos, donde los parámetros del prior se modelan como variables aleatorias con sus propios priors, lo que aporta flexibilidad. Otra estrategia es el uso de modelos no paramétricos bayesianos, que permiten definir priors más generales y adaptativos. Además, en el aprendizaje profundo, se han desarrollado técnicas que aprenden priors mediante meta-aprendizaje o durante la optimización.

Ventajas y Limitaciones

El uso del prior en inteligencia artificial presenta tanto ventajas como limitaciones. Entre sus principales beneficios está la posibilidad de incorporar conocimiento previo, lo que mejora la robustez y precisión de los modelos, especialmente cuando los datos son escasos o ruidosos. También actúa como regularizador, ayudando a evitar el sobreajuste y favoreciendo la generalización. Sin embargo, su principal limitación radica en la subjetividad al definirlo, ya que un prior mal elegido puede sesgar los resultados. Además, en modelos complejos, puede aumentar el costo computacional y dificultar la interpretación. Su eficacia depende del contexto y la calidad de la información previa disponible. 

Futuro del Priors en la IA

El futuro de los priors en inteligencia artificial apunta hacia enfoques más automáticos, adaptativos y contextuales. Con el avance del aprendizaje profundo y el aprendizaje bayesiano, se están desarrollando métodos que permiten aprender priors directamente a partir de datos o a través del meta-aprendizaje, lo que reduce la necesidad de intervención manual. Además, los priors dinámicos, que se ajustan en tiempo real según el entorno o la tarea, ganarán relevancia en sistemas autónomos. En aplicaciones críticas como medicina, seguridad o robótica, los priors seguirán siendo clave para manejar la incertidumbre de forma segura. También veremos una integración más estrecha con modelos generativos y redes neuronales probabilísticas. 

Comparte este Post:

Posts Relacionados

Character Set

En el desarrollo de software trabajamos constantemente con texto: nombres de usuarios, mensajes, datos importados, logs, comunicación entre servicios… y detrás de todo ese texto existe un concepto fundamental que a menudo pasa desapercibido: el character set o conjunto de caracteres. Si los character codes representan “cómo se codifica un

Ver Blog »

Character Code

En el desarrollo de software hay conceptos que parecen simples hasta que un día causan un bug extraño y, de repente, se convierten en una fuente de frustración y aprendizaje. Uno de esos conceptos es el character code, la forma en que las computadoras representan los símbolos que vemos en

Ver Blog »

CHAOS METHOD

Dentro del ecosistema del desarrollo de software existen metodologías para todos los gustos. Algunas son rígidas y estructuradas; otras, tan flexibles que parecen filosofías de vida. Y luego existe algo que no está en los manuales, no aparece en certificaciones y, sin embargo, es sorprendentemente común en equipos de todas

Ver Blog »

Visita a 42 Madrid

MSMK participa en un taller de Inteligencia Artificial en 42 Madrid     Madrid, [18/11/2025] Los alumnos de MSMK University College, participaron en un taller intensivo de Inteligencia Artificial aplicada al desarrollo web en 42 Madrid, uno de los campus tecnológicos más innovadores de Europa. La actividad tuvo como objetivo que

Ver Blog »
Query Language

Query Language

Definición de Lenguaje de Consulta en IA El lenguaje de consulta en inteligencia artificial es una herramienta formal utilizada para interactuar con bases de datos, sistemas de conocimiento o modelos inteligentes mediante preguntas estructuradas. Su objetivo principal es recuperar, filtrar o inferir información relevante de forma eficiente, especialmente cuando los

Ver Blog »
Quantum Computing

Quantum Computing

¿Qué es la Computación Cuántica? La computación cuántica es un nuevo paradigma de procesamiento de información basado en las leyes de la mecánica cuántica. A diferencia de la computación clásica, que utiliza bits que solo pueden estar en 0 o 1, la computación cuántica emplea qubits, los cuales pueden estar

Ver Blog »

Déjanos tus datos, nosotros te llamamos

Leave us your details and we will send you the program link.

Déjanos tus datos y 
te enviaremos el link del white paper

Déjanos tus datos y 
te enviaremos el link de la revista

Déjanos tus datos y 
te enviaremos el link del programa